def __scif_recipe(self): """Generate the SCI-F recipe instructions, merging primitives of the same type because SCI-F does not support duplicate sections.""" recipe = [] if self.__appenv: appenv = self.__appenv[0].merge(self.__appenv, _app=self.__name) recipe.append(appenv) if self.__appfiles: appfiles = self.__appfiles[0].merge(self.__appfiles, _app=self.__name) recipe.append(appfiles) if self.__apphelp: apphelp = self.__apphelp[0].merge(self.__apphelp, _app=self.__name) recipe.append(apphelp) if self.__appinstall: _appenv = False if hpccm.config.g_ctype == container_type.SINGULARITY: # If the container type is Singularity, load the # general container environment _appenv = True appinstall = self.__appinstall[0].merge(self.__appinstall, _app=self.__name, _appenv=_appenv) recipe.append(appinstall) if self.__applabels: applabels = self.__applabels[0].merge(self.__applabels, _app=self.__name) recipe.append(applabels) if self.__apprun: apprun = self.__apprun[0].merge(self.__apprun, _app=self.__name) recipe.append(apprun) else: # Shell one liner to run a command if specified, # otherwise start a shell recipe.append( runscript(commands=[ 'eval "if [[ $# -eq 0 ]]; then exec /bin/bash; else exec $@; fi"' ], _args=False, _app=self.__name, _exec=False)) if self.__apptest: apptest = self.__apptest[0].merge(self.__apptest, _app=self.__name, _test=True) recipe.append(apptest) return recipe

def build(container_format='singularity', os_release='ubuntu', os_version='20.04', conda_packages=['conda', 'numpy', 'scipy', 'pandas'], python_version='3.9.1', channels=['anaconda', 'defaults', 'conda-forge'], anaconda_version='4.9.2'): config.set_container_format(container_format) image = f'{os_release}:{os_version}' stage0 = Stage(name='stage0') stage0 += baseimage(image=image, _bootstrap='docker') stage0 += environment(variables={ 'LC_ALL': 'en_AU.UTF-8', 'LANGUAGE': 'en_AU.UTF-8', }) stage0 += label(metadata={ 'maintainer': 'Luhan Cheng', 'email': '*****@*****.**' }) stage0 += shell(commands=[ 'rm /usr/bin/sh', 'ln -s /usr/bin/bash /usr/bin/sh', '/usr/bin/bash' ]) stage0 += packages(apt=[ 'wget', 'git', 'software-properties-common', 'build-essential', 'locales' ]) stage0 += shell(commands=['locale-gen en_AU.UTF-8']) stage0 += conda(eula=True, packages=[f'python={python_version}'] + conda_packages, channels=channels, version=anaconda_version) stage0 += environment(variables=from_prefix('/usr/local/anaconda')) stage0 += runscript(commands=[ 'source /usr/local/anaconda/etc/profile.d/conda.sh', '/usr/local/anaconda/bin/python3 $*' ]) return stage0
